Comprehending the Anatomy of a Sash Window
Before starting any repair project, it is crucial to comprehend the complex "[Box Sash Windows](http://www.seafishzone.com/home.php?mod=space&uid=2783612) and sheave" system that enables the windows to work. Unlike contemporary casement windows that swing on hinges, a sash window depends on a system of counterweights hidden within the frame.
Secret Components:The Sashes: The movable glazed panels (upper and lower).The Box Frame: The outer frame that houses the weights and sashes.Sash Cords: Heavy-duty ropes (generally wax-coated cotton) that connect the sashes to the weights.Pulleys: The wheels at the [Top Sash Windows](https://just-blake.blogbright.net/5-clarifications-on-sash-window-architectural-details) of the frame over which the cable runs.Weights: Lead or iron cylinders that stabilize the weight of the sash.Parting Bead: A vertical strip of wood that keeps the upper and lower sashes from rubbing against each other.Staff Bead: The ornamental moulding that holds the sash in location within the box frame.The Sill: The bottom-most horizontal part of the frame, the majority of prone to water damage.Fix vs. Replacement: Making the Right Choice

1. Broken Sash Cords
The most common failure in a sash window is a snapped cable. When this occurs, the sash will either fall shut or become impossible to remain open. Repairing a cord involves eliminating the personnel beads, securing the sash, and accessing the "pocket" in the side of the frame to reattach the weight to a brand-new, premium cable.
2. Lumber Decay and Rot
The sill and the bottom rail of the lower sash are the most vulnerable as they gather rainwater. If the wood is soft to the touch, it indicates rot.
Minor Rot: Can be treated by eliminating the soft wood and using a liquid lumber hardener followed by a high-strength wood filler.Major Rot: May need "splicing," where the harmed area of wood is eliminated and a brand-new piece of skilled wood (accoya or mahogany) is glued and screwed in its place.3. Drafts and Rattles
Older sash windows frequently have a gap between the sashes and the frame. This not only lets in cold air however enables the windows to rattle in the wind. The contemporary solution includes "upgrading and draught-proofing." This involves routing a little channel into the beads and the conference rail to install discreet brush strips. These strips seal the spaces without affecting the window's motion.
4. Over-Painting
Years of slapdash painting typically result in "painted shut" windows. This happens when paint bonds the sash to the frame or the parting bead. Repair requires carefully cutting the paint seal with a sharp knife and sanding down the "cheeks" of the frame to guarantee a smooth move.

While small jobs like painting or installing fundamental draught strips can be a DIY project, structural repairs generally require a specialist. Sash windows are precisely stabilized; if a property owner replaces a single-pane glass with a heavier double-glazed unit without changing the internal weights, the window will no longer remain open.
Moreover, older windows may consist of lead-based paint. Specialists utilize specific extraction techniques to make sure that toxic lead dust is not launched into the home throughout the sanding procedure.

Yes, in a lot of cases. If the existing sash is thick enough (usually at least 35mm-42mm), a specialist can "slimline" double-glazing systems into the initial frames. Nevertheless, the internal weights must be increased to compensate for the heavier glass.
2. Why does my sash window rattle?
Rattling is usually triggered by a gap between the sashes and the beads that hold them in place. Over years, the wood can shrink somewhat. Setting up a draught-proofing system with brush piles is the most reliable way to stop the movement while enhancing thermal performance.
3. The length of time does a sash window repair work take?
A basic "overhaul and draught-proof" (consisting of cord replacement) typically takes one day per window for an expert. More comprehensive wood repair work including splicing and sill replacement might take two days.
4. Is it possible to repair a window that is "painted shut"?
Definitely. It is a common issue. By using a "window zipper" tool or a sharp scheme knife and a hammer, the paint bond can be broken. When open, the excess paint is removed back to the bare wood to ensure the window operates efficiently again.
5. What is the finest wood for sash window repairs?
Accoya is currently thought about the market gold standard. It is a cured wood that is virtually rot-proof and does not shrink or swell with the seasons, making it perfect for the moving parts of a sash window.
